Overview Of The Role Citi, the leading global bank, has approximately 200 million customer accounts and does business in more than 160 countries and jurisdictions. Citi provides consumers, corporations, governments, and institutions with a broad range of financial products and services, including consumer banking and credit, corporate and investment banking, securities brokerage, transaction services, and wealth management.

Position Overview The GenAI Integration Architect will serve as the technical leader for GenAI adoption across all CISO domains, responsible for designing and overseeing the integration of GenAI capabilities into existing cybersecurity workflows, tools, and processes. This role bridges the gap between GenAI product development and enterprise‑scale deployment, ensuring that GenAI tools deliver measurable business value while maintaining security, compliance, and operational excellence. It is a high‑impact role reporting to the Head of GenAI & Emerging Technology Security, working closely with CISO domain leaders, product teams, and technology partners to accelerate the organization’s GenAI transformation.
